タグ別アーカイブ: SEMI Standard

WiresharkにHSMS dissectorを追加したいので参考資料を集める

半導体製造装置とホストとの間の通信にはSEMI Standardで標準化されているHSMS-SS/SECS-IIというプロトコルが使われるのが一般的なのだが、このデバッグツール類はお高いものが多い。Wiresharkにも専用のdissectorはついてないので、自分でプラグインを書くか、サードパーティのdissector pluginを探すしかない。dissectorはDLLまたはLuaスクリプトとして追加できるらしい。

Wireshark Developer’s Guide

How can I add a custom protocol analyzer to wireshark? - StackOverflow

問題児たちがwiresharkのdissectorをLuaで書くそうですよ? - 迷い庭

というか、ここに古いpluginのソースコードが置いてあった。
Bug 8879 - HSMS protocol dissector plugin bug
古くて動作はしないけど、参考にはなりそう。ただ、今はLuaで書いたほうがいいんだろうか。